Output 999d72afde49fb49ff8961cc3101abcc3a25d951ba498fd4d5a671931aadfa1e:34

value
4499494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1addd60dd99b828356a82b45a27ab404f9a3195f OP_EQUAL
address
3495EydVWsfgzosTJQSG8JqbpBW3RteQk2
transaction
999d72afde49fb49ff8961cc3101abcc3a25d951ba498fd4d5a671931aadfa1e
confirmations
205973
spent
true